What is a Marketing Funnel?
A marketing funnel is a strategic framework used to visualize and guide the client journey from preliminary awareness to final purchase, categorizing consumers into distinct phases: the top of the funnel (ToFu), middle of the funnel (MoFu), and bottom of the funnel (BoFu). This structure helps in comprehending customer experience at each stage.

This model allows services to comprehend how to engage clients through targeted marketing techniques at each stage, helping with a smooth shift toward sales conversion and client relationships. By examining various marketing channels, brand names can carry out reliable strategies that improve client relationships, adjust buyer personas, and cultivate brand name awareness throughout the whole purchase cycle with the help of analytics tools.

Client Lifetime Value
Client life time value (CLV) is a vital metric that quantifies the total revenue a service can prepare for from a single consumer throughout their relationship. This metric supplies valuable insights into the long-term effectiveness of the marketing funnel. By comprehending CLV, organizations can more effectively examine their marketing techniques, designate resources judiciously, and align their efforts with overarching service goals.

Determining CLV entails a number of actions, including identifying the average purchase value, the purchase frequency, and the expected client lifespan. The formula typically employed is as follows:

CLV = Typical Purchase Value �- Purchase Frequency �- Consumer Life-span
This metric is necessary for evaluating marketing performance, as it provides a quote of the revenue generated per customer, significantly affecting budgeting choices and marketing strategies.

To improve CLV, organizations must focus on customer retention and execute loyalty programs that reward repeat service. Prospective techniques may consist of leveraging SEO tools to improve online exposure:

Customized marketing efforts that align with private customer choices.
Regular engagement through e-mails, studies, and social networks to cultivate strong connections.
Incentivizing referrals to draw in new customers through existing pleased customers.
By incorporating these improvements, organizations can cultivate increased consumer commitment and enhance CLV, which will directly affect general profitability.

Roi
Return on investment (ROI) is a vital metric for assessing the monetary success of a marketing funnel, as it shows the effectiveness of marketing expenditures in producing revenue. By evaluating ROI, organizations can identify which marketing channels and strategies offer the greatest returns, consequently enhancing resource allotment and informing future marketing decisions.

To precisely calculate ROI, businesses frequently utilize the formula: ROI = (Net Profit/ Expense of Financial Investment) x 100%. This formula enables online marketers to measure the worth created from their projects relative to the costs incurred.

For instance, if a company launches a social media campaign with an expenditure of $10,000 that leads to $50,000 in sales, the ROI would be 400%. Using sophisticated analytics tools, such as Google Analytics or HubSpot, significantly enhances ROI analysis, making it possible for business to keep an eye on engagement levels, conversion rates, and customer acquisition costs.

For instance, a merchant might track email projects to recognize the most effective messaging and target demographics.
This data gears up marketers to make educated adjustments, facilitating continuous enhancement of their strategies in time.
By leveraging these insights, businesses can fine-tune their marketing initiatives and guarantee that their financial investments yield optimum success.
